WASHINGTON, D.C. – Today, the Department of Energy (DOE) announced the allocation of $6.3 billion in industrial decarbonization grants funded by the Inflation Reduction Act and Bipartisan Infrastructure Law, a significant step toward transforming heavily-emitting manufacturing sectors including aluminum and steel. Projects supporting retrofits and transformative technologies at aluminum and steel facilities in Ohio, Pennsylvania and likely Kentucky, were among the awardees.

Yesterday, sixteen attorneys general filed a lawsuit against the Biden administration over the recently announced pause on approvals of new gas exports, known as LNG. The temporary pause is in place to give the Department of Energy time to update the outdated studies it uses to determine the environmental and economic impacts of increasing LNG exports, something the agency is required to do under the Natural Gas Act.
